Turning the ringer on your iPhone 14 is a straightforward task that ensures you don’t miss any important calls or notifications. To quickly do this, locate the physical switch on the side of your phone, usually on the left above the volume buttons. Simply flip this switch upwards to turn on the ringer.
Step-by-Step Guide to Turn Ringer on iPhone 14
This step-by-step guide will walk you through the process of turning your iPhone 14 ringer on, ensuring you hear calls and alerts as they come in.
Step 1: Find the Ring/Silent Switch
Locate the small switch on the left side of the iPhone.
This switch is situated above the volume buttons. When the switch is flipped upwards, the ringer is on; when down, it’s silent.
Step 2: Flip the Switch Upwards
Gently push the switch upwards to turn on the ringer.
You’ll know the ringer is on because you won’t see the orange color beneath the switch, and you might feel a small vibration if your phone is set to vibrate.
Step 3: Adjust Ringer Volume
Use the volume buttons to adjust the ringer volume to your preferred level.
Sometimes, the ringer might be on, but the volume is too low. Press the volume up button to increase the sound.
Step 4: Check Settings App
Open the Settings app, then tap ‘Sounds & Haptics’ to ensure the ringer is on.
In the event the physical switch isn’t working, the settings app lets you manually adjust sound settings.
Step 5: Test the Ringer
Call your iPhone from another device to confirm the ringer is working.
By testing, you’ll know for sure that everything is functioning as expected.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I know if the ringer is on or off?
You can tell by looking at the ring/silent switch; if you see orange, the phone is on silent.
What if my ringer switch is broken?
Use the AssistiveTouch feature in the accessibility settings for an on-screen option to turn the ringer on or off.
Can I change the ringer volume without the buttons?
Yes, you can adjust it within the ‘Sounds & Haptics’ section of the Settings app.
Why is my iPhone not ringing even when the ringer is on?
Ensure Do Not Disturb is not activated and check for any audio output devices like Bluetooth headphones connected.
How do I set different ringtones for contacts?
In the Contacts app, tap on a contact, select ‘Edit’, then choose ‘Ringtone’ to set your preferred tone.
